The Little Rock Doubletree Hotel, Ark. overlooks the Arkansas River in the downtown business district, and is seven miles from Little Rock National Airport. Catering to business travelers, the hotel is close to most all downtown businesses, as well as both of Little Rock's convention centers. Guest are within walking distance to major attractions including President Clinton Library and Park, and adjacent to the Court House, and Robinson Center Music Hall. Shopping, dining and entertainment is just a seven blocks away in the River Market District. The hotel features an outdoor pool, 24-hour front desk, concierge, evening room service, business center, fitness center, conference rooms, on-site gift shop and event catering. The Doubletree's in-house restaurant, the Plaza Grille serves true Southern fare offering daily breakfast buffets, lunch buffets with sandwiches and salads, and nightly specials feature grilled meats and seafood. The Plaza Bar is open late offering appetizers and cocktails. Guestrooms have city or rivers views with satellite television, high-speed Internet access, and coffeemakers.
